Job Description

The Finance Shared Services Manager will ensure that the income and expenditure, including treasury, purchase to pay, order to cash, capital, intercompany and all other financial transactions are accounted for in the accounting records of the UK/Swiss registered companies on behalf of INEOS Olefins and Polymers Europe, INEOS FPS and several other smaller INEOS businesses predominately based on the Grangemouth site in accordance with the IFRS accounting rules, Group policies and procedures so that monthly management accounts and annual statutory accounts can then be prepared in an accurate and timely manner.

The role includes a position within the leadership team, a fundamental element of the role is the active coaching and development of the more junior members of the team acting as a role-model in your approach and actions,  participating in key projects as SME for financial accounting matters. You will take hands on approach supporting the team leads particularly on the annual statutory accounts preparation and review process.  The role will report to the CFO for Olefins & Polymers UK.

The purpose of this role is to organise the Transactional Finance Team to ensure all ACTUAL historical financial information is accounted for and reported on accurately and within strict deadlines.
The role holder will be able to organise and direct all elements of Financial Accounting to ensure accurate Management and Statutory Accounts can be prepared for the legal entities under our control.

The post holder will also be able to develop strong relationships with other the other Finance and Business functions to work collaboratively across all business functions to enable efficient and accurate management account preparation and reporting. The candidate must possess excellent technical accounting skills, detailed analytical skills and the ability to problem solve. Finally, the candidate must be able to demonstrate strong written and verbal communication skills.

  • No of UK and Swiss legal entities with direct responsibility 12, turnover approx. €9bn annually. Team of 40 people with 4 direct reports

Principle accountabilities

  • Responsible for transactional accounting service including but not limited to Financial and Statutory reporting, Treasury, Accounts Payable, ERP systems and BI reporting control.
  • Responsible for ensuring the accounting systems are operating efficiently and effectively supervising the Systems Administrator effectively.
  • Ensure that, each month, all financial transactions, for the aforementioned areas are accounted for accurately for INEOS Group.
  • Close the month end in line with the timetable.
  • Coordinate the preparation of the monthly balance sheet reconciliations each month and ensure that they are reviewed and approved.
  • Complete any legal financial returns for the company as directed by the business CFO’s.
  • Provide the monthly VAT returns information to the appropriate authorities.
  • Provide any other tax information to the Tax Manager as required
  • Support the annual budgeting and regular forecasting processes with information as required.
  • Support the risk assessment system as required.
  • Support the continuous improvement processes as required.
  • Support the business and financial and planning analysts in providing historical financial information when required or to show the requestor where, in the system, the information can be found
  • Support the Group Tax and Treasury team in providing accurate financial information where required.
  • Ensure all key financial controls are operating as required and work with the Risk and Controls Manager to ensure all the controls that are in existence are required and redundant controls are retired.
  • Supervising and appraising staff.
  • Continually challenge current thinking and make recommendations on how to optimise business opportunities and minimise risk/cost to the business.
  • Any additional ad hoc duties as required.
